Arii Matambe (the Royal End)
Arii Matambe (the Royal End), by Paul Gauguin, 1892, French Post-Impressionist painting, oil on canvas. This painting is a fanaticized scene of the decapitated human head of Tahitian King Pomare V, ritually displayed after his death. For Gauguin, his deat (BSLOC_2016_6_37)
